Ear Oil

In small quantities, ear wax can actually be very useful. It's a natural cleanser as it moves from inside your ear canal outward, gathering dead skin cells and dirt along the way! For many, ear wax can block their ear passages and cause earaches. These over-the counter drops can be used to help remove any clogs.

Collagen Protein

Collagen is a simple to digest protein supplement that aids the body in replacing what it has lost through ageing. Collagen supplements can help smoothen wrinkles, improve skin elasticity, and many other benefits. It is great for supporting connective tissue and improving joint pain. Collagen's anti-inflammatory properties help to reduce joint pain. Collagen protein can strengthen bones and slow down bone loss.

Air purifying plants (for your home or office).

Indoor plants can help make your indoor spaces feel more alive. In addition to adding aesthetic value, studies have shown that indoor plants can reduce indoor air pollution.
